Site info
  • Domain:meituxiuxiu2013.com
  • Title:美图秀秀官方下载2013 美图秀秀下载2014网页版在线使用
  • Global Traffic Rank:0
  • Area Traffic Rank: Traffic Rank in :
  • Unique Visitors:
  • Sites Linking In:0
  • IP-Address:142.54.180.11
  • Server:LTANMP/1.0
Server Info
  • Domain:meituxiuxiu2013.com
  • Server Location: United States , Massachusetts , Wakefield
  • Latitude:42.5013
  • Longitude:-71.0689
  • Postal Code:01880
  • Update: